Practical Guidance for Creative Implementation
To get the most out of these design assets, it is important to approach their integration with intention. Here are some practical recommendations for incorporating Cute Bunny Clipart into your workflow:
- Evaluate Project Fit: Before diving in, consider the tone of your project. While these bunnies are versatile, they lean towards playful and warm. They are ideal for baby showers, spring campaigns, Easter promotions, and family-oriented brands. For ultra-corporate or serious financial sectors, they might need to be used sparingly or paired with more structured typography to balance the whimsy.
- Test Font Pairings: Since these are graphic elements and not a typeface, their interaction with text is critical. If you are creating a poster or invitation, pair these illustrations with clean sans serif font options for a modern look, or a gentle script font for a more traditional, handcrafted feel. Avoid overly decorative fonts that might compete with the details of the bunny illustrations. The goal is harmony, not competition.
- Check Resolution and Scaling: Although these files are 300 DPI, always check your final output size. For large banners or outdoor advertising, ensure you are not scaling the image beyond its optimal dimensions, which could introduce softness. For web design, remember to compress the PNGs appropriately to maintain fast load times without sacrificing visual quality on retina displays.
- Layering and Depth: Use the transparent backgrounds to your advantage by layering the bunnies over textured papers, pastel gradients, or photographic backgrounds. This creates depth and makes the design feel more dynamic. In scrapbooking or digital planning, this technique adds a tactile quality that flat images often lack.
- Licensing and Commercial Use: Always review the licensing terms associated with your purchase. Most premium clipart collections allow for commercial use in end products like printed cards or clothing, but may restrict reselling the digital files themselves. Understanding these boundaries protects your business and respects the creator’s work.
When creating sublimation designs for clothing, pay attention to color contrast. If you are printing on dark fabrics, you may need to add a white underbase or choose bunny elements with bold outlines to ensure they pop. For light fabrics, the natural transparency works beautifully, allowing the fabric texture to show through slightly, which can add a nice organic feel to the final garment.
